Kajabi stays your course and offer platform. Automola helps run the customer work around it — answering questions from your real materials, recovering checkouts, and following up after purchase.

Short answer

Automola + Kajabi means Automola can act as an AI workflow layer around Kajabi: it watches approved signals, drafts or runs routine next steps, holds sensitive decisions, and leaves a receipt tied to the source.

Workflows

What actually runs around Kajabi.

Practical workflow patterns, not a claim of a certified app.

Signal Automola action Owner control
A student question arrives Answers from your course, offer, and policy docs. Holds anything uncertain or sensitive.
A checkout is abandoned Runs the approved recovery. Stops if they buy or opt out.
A purchase completes Sends the approved onboarding and follow-up. Logs every touch.

Approval model

What never happens without your word.

Automola is built around a simple rule: it can move routine work, but it stops before anything that makes a new promise, changes access, affects money, or touches a sensitive customer situation.

Guardrail Automola works only with the Kajabi access you connect.
Guardrail No claim of a certified Kajabi app unless separately established.
Guardrail Refunds and broad sends wait for approval.
